Here are some signs that your boyfriend might be losing interest after being together for six years:
Less Communication: He may not initiate conversations as often as he used to, or his messages might be shorter and less engaging.
Reduced Quality Time: If he starts to decline invitations to spend time together or seems distracted when you are together, it could be a sign.
Limited Affection: Notice if there’s a decrease in physical affection like hugs, kisses, or cuddling.
Avoidance of Future Plans: If he seems disinterested in talking about the future or making plans together, it could indicate a lack of commitment.
Increased Focus on Other Activities: If he prioritizes time with friends, hobbies, or work over your relationship, it might be an indication of shifting priorities.
Less Effort in the Relationship: If he stops making an effort to show you he cares or plan special dates, this could be a worrying sign.
Changes in Communication Style: If he becomes more critical or dismissive in conversations, it may reflect a change in feelings.
Withdrawal from Emotional Sharing: If he stops sharing his thoughts and feelings with you, it could indicate a growing emotional distance.
Avoiding Conflict Resolution: If he no longer wants to address issues or conflicts in the relationship, it may suggest a lack of investment in maintaining the relationship.
Body Language: His non-verbal cues might change; look out for a lack of eye contact or closed-off postures.
It’s important to have an open and honest conversation with him about your concerns. Communication is key to understanding each other’s feelings and addressing any issues in the relationship.
